I had a really bad habit (for a few summers) of sitting in the sun for an hour or two on weekends, on purpose, to try and lighten my hair naturally. The top layers that got lightened have significantly more breakage and the underneath layers that are still darker are notably silkier and grow longer with less damage at the ends. I even had cut layers into my hair because the bottom length never needs a trim as much as the top layers. I committed last October to stopping that habit for good, and I'm really looking forward to seeing how the texture of the top layers improves over the next few years.
